Aenor was born about 1084 in Barnstaple, Devonshire, England, the daughter of unknown parents.
She died in 1153. The place is not known.
Her husband was Philip De Braose. They were married, but the date and place have not been found. Their only known child was William (1112-1192).

Aenor Eva de Totenais
Also Known As: "Eleanor of Barnstaple", "Eleanor de Totnais", "Totnes"
Birthdate: circa 1084
Birthplace: Barnstaple, Devonshire, England
Death: 1153
Immediate Family:
Daughter of Lord Judeal Juhel de Totenais, of Barnstable and Bertha de Picquigny
Wife of Philip de Braose, 2nd Lord of Bramber
Mother of Robert de Braose; William de Braose II, 3rd Lord of Bramber; Basilia de Braose; Gillian de Braose; Maud Matilda de Braose and 1 other
Sister of Alfred de Totenais and N.N. de Totenais
